Job Description

  • The COP will provide leadership and oversight over the design and implementation of the project. S/he will serve as Genesis Analytic's primary point of contact for USAID/Uganda on this project.
  • She/he will provide strategic direction, technical leadership, and ensure ethical and excellent management of the project and its staff (including consortium members).
  • S/he will routinely liaise with the senior leadership and relevant divisions at MoH, as well as with technical advisors from USAID, USG implementing partner organizations and other relevant development partner organizations to cultivate an environment that encourages collaborative and productive engagement to support the implementation of this project.
  • S/he will provide quality assurance and review of all deliverables submitted to USAID. These shall include the AMELP and work plan at the start of the project, as well as quarterly and annual technical and financial reports. Occasionally, s/he will be called upon to make presentations to USAID (and its partners) on specific aspects of the project that might be of interest.
  • S/he will be expected to identify key issues and risks related to program implementation in a timely manner, suggest appropriate program adjustments, and ensure that systems are in place to mitigate the risk of fraud, waste, and abuse.

Required Qualifications

  • Master’s degree or other advanced degree (PhD, MD) in a relevant field such as public health; health systems; development studies social sciences or management; and other relevant fields.
  • Minimum of 10 years’ progressive experience in a senior role managing large, complex, and integrated health system strengthening projects.
  • Proven ability to work collaboratively with the Uganda Ministry of Health (MoH), USG agencies, Government of Uganda (GoU) departments,, development partner organizations, the private sector, and civil society organizations.
  • Demonstrated experience in successfully leading and managing multi-disciplinary teams of senior technical persons to achieve project results in a fast-paced and complex environment.
  • Demonstrated experience in establishing and maintaining strong relationships with key stakeholders within GoU and USG agencies.
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, including writing and presentation skills in the English language

Desired Qualifications

  • Previous experience as a Chief of Party, Deputy Chief of Party or Technical Director for USAID funded projects in Uganda, preferably in one of the areas of focus: healthcare financing; human resources for health; health information systems; and community health systems.
  • S/he should have recent experience working with government counterparts in different capacities.
  • Excellent understanding of the healthcare system in Uganda, including the key stakeholders and on-going work within the health system strengthening space.
  • Familiarity with relevant national strategies like the Uganda Health Sector Strategic and Implementation Plan, the National Development Plan, and USG documents like the USAID/Uganda CDCS 2022 - 2027, the USAID Vision for Health System Strengthening 2030 et cetera.
